Corbin Trucking Co. v. Stewart

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District
Feb 8, 1973
280 So. 2d 455 (Fla. Dist. Ct. App. 1973)

Opinion

No. R-303.

February 8, 1973. Certiorari denied. See 278 So.2d 627.

Appeal from Circuit Court, Jackson County; Robert L. McCrary, Jr., Judge.

W. Paul Thompson, De Funiak Springs, for appellant.

John E. Roberts, of Roberts Sheffield, Marianna, for appellee.


This cause having been orally argued before the Court, the briefs and record on appeal having been read and given full consideration, and the appellant having failed to demonstrate reversible error, the final summary judgment of the lower court appealed from herein is affirmed.

SPECTOR, C.J., and RAWLS and JOHNSON, JJ., concur.
